Aisling - "Trath na Gaoth"
[Self Financed, 2003]
Aisling - Trath na Gaoth
Tracklist:
01. Memories Of A Timeless Vision
02. Laoidhan Fogharach Na Dubhachas Agus T-Aisling Agam
03. The Shining Darkness (Omega)

Aisling hail from Italy and "Trath na Gaoth" is their latest mini cd released back in 2003. It is two years old but I think that their music can stand these days too. Even if it has a huge minus,talking about the production, all other things are almost perfect.

So what do we have here? Three songs which travel us a trip to the pagan metal with a lot of symphonic elements. For those who don't know, pagan metal is a mixture of black metal with some traditional music elements which usually are the music from the ancient age where man lived in a perfect harmony with the nature.

Personally I love all these three tracks from their latest release, but because of the production, the whole result isn't so good. Sometimes you can barely hear all the instruments. I wish that Aisling, with their next release, will improve in this section, because in the section of the music, they are almost perfect, with very clever ideas inside the songs and well worked compositions. Also the change between the black metal vocals and the clean ones are very clever.
